## Limits & Quotas: Inkpress PDF Renderer

Heads up for the security review — Inkpress renders invoices in a sandboxed worker, and we clamp pretty much everything: page counts, embedded image sizes, font payloads, and render wall-time. Oversized jobs get rejected up front rather than partially rendered, so there's no truncated-output ambiguity to exploit. These caps are enforced before the sandbox spins up. The ceilings are:

tuning table, yajog-yahof:
BUDGETS = {
    "lamvan": 303,
    "wenox": 460,
    "fenvan": 525,
}

## Further Reading

Flaky integration tests in the Pennywhistle payments service remain our top CI noise source. Most failures trace to the sandbox ledger resetting mid-suite or the mock acquirer timing out under parallel runs. Quarantine policy: two flakes in seven days gets the test tagged and pulled from the merge gate. Retry logic is a last resort, not a fix. Full triage history and current quarantine list are on the internal page below.

operations page: https://jenkins.zemvarcloud.local/job/merge_requests/repo/build/73930b4b30f0a8ed

Onboarding: Replica Lag Alarm (Tidewatch DB). Alarm fires when read-replica lag on the Tidewatch cluster exceeds 90s. Release managers: hold all releases touching the orders schema until lag clears. Check the Pinegate dashboard, confirm replication thread is running, and escalate if lag climbs past 5 minutes. If the monitoring agent itself is down, restart it via the recovery console, which prompts for the passphrase provided below.

vault phrase of tawig-taduf = zorath-oliwyn